So I got my hands on these Hoss Weedless Football Jigheads. I was so excited when I heard they announced these. They are marketed as being able to enable us to fish right up against structure without snagging. I was like “Yeah right, let’s see about that!” I chose the 3/0 size with a 1/4 oz weight.
- Setting it up:
First thing I did was rig this bad boy up. I paired it with my go-to soft plastic, I won’t mention a specific brand, but let’s just say it’s a craw-type bait that’s been pretty reliable. The football head design is supposed to help the jig stand up and make the bait look lively, even when it’s just sitting on the bottom.
- First Cast:
I remember that first cast like it was yesterday. I was near some rocky structure, you know, the kind of place that eats lures for breakfast. I took a deep breath, made my cast, and let it sink. I could feel the jig bumping along the bottom, and I was just waiting for that inevitable snag… but it didn’t happen! I was able to work it through some pretty gnarly stuff without getting hung up once.
- Working It:
I spent the next few hours just experimenting with different retrieves. Slow drags, little hops, you name it. This setup was handling it all like a champ. The weedless design really does work wonders. I was pulling it through rocks, over branches, and around docks without any issues. It’s like having a secret weapon.
- Catching Some Fish:
Now, the real test, right? Did it actually catch fish? Well, I’m happy to report that it did. I landed a few decent-sized bass that day, nothing huge, but definitely keepers. They seemed to really dig the action of the bait on this jighead. It was like the combination of the football head and the weedless design made it irresistible to them.
